The Science of Smart Learning: Research-Proven Strategies to Study Smarter, Understand Deeper, and Remember Longer
by Rolando Asisten, Jr.
Why do some students forget what they study within hours, while others recall it months later? Why do some learners thrive on exams, while others struggle despite long hours of preparation?
The answer isn’t luck or talent—it’s strategy.
In The Science of Smart Learning, educator Rolando Asisten, Jr. blends real student stories with decades of research from psychology, neuroscience, and education. The result is a practical, evidence-based guide to learning that lasts.
Inside, you’ll discover:
Why rereading and highlighting fail—and what to do instead.
How retrieval practice, spaced repetition, and interleaving make knowledge stick.
Note-taking systems like the Cornell Method that turn lectures into learning tools.
Time management strategies, memory palaces, and the Feynman Technique.
How to prepare for finals, board exams, and lifelong learning challenges.
Each chapter combines science, stories, and step-by-step strategies you can use immediately—whether you’re a student, a parent, a teacher, or a professional.
Study smarter. Understand deeper. Remember longer.
This is not just another study guide. It’s your roadmap to lasting learning.
